< Psalms 80 >

1 To the choirmaster to Shoshannim eduth of Asaph a psalm. O shepherd of Israel - give ear! O [you who] lead like flock Joseph O [you who] sit the cherubim shine forth!
For the leader. On shoshannim, eduth. Of Asaph, a psalm. Listen, Shepherd of Israel, who leads Joseph like a flock of sheep; from your throne on the cherubs shine forth
2 Before Ephraim - and Benjamin and Manasseh stir up! might your and come! for salvation of us.
before Ephraim, Manasseh, and Benjamin. Stir up your mighty power, come to our help.
3 O God restore us and make shine face your so let us be delivered.
God, restore us: show us the light of your face, so we may be saved.
4 O Yahweh God of hosts until when? have you smoked at [the] prayer of people your.
O Lord of hosts, how long is your anger to smoke, despite the prayer of your people?
5 You have fed them bread of tear[s] and you have made drink them tears a third of a measure.
You have fed them with bread of tears, you have made them drink tears by the measure.
6 You make us a contention to neighbors our and enemies our they mock themselves.
The scorn of our neighbors you make us, the laughing-stock of our foes.
7 O God of hosts restore us and make shine face your so let us be delivered.
God of hosts, restore us: show us the light of your face, so we may be saved.
8 A vine from Egypt you uprooted you drove out nations and you planted it.
A vine out of Egypt you brought; you did drive out the nations, and plant her;
9 You made clear before it and it took root roots its and it filled [the] land.
in the ground you did clear she struck root, and she filled all the land.
10 They were covered mountains shade its and branches its [the] cedars of God.
The shade of her covered the mountains, her branches the cedars of God.
11 It stretched out branch[es] its to [the] sea and to [the] river young shoots its.
She sent forth her shoots to the sea, and her branches as far as the River.
12 Why? have you broken down walls its and they have plucked it all [those who] pass by of [the] road.
Why have you torn down her fences, and left her to be plucked at by all who pass by,
13 It eats away it wild boar from [the] forest and moving creature[s] of [the] field it grazes on it.
to be gnawed by the boar from the forest, and devoured by the beasts of the field?
14 O God of hosts return please pay attention from heaven and see and attend to vine this.
O God of hosts, return: look down from heaven and see and visit this vine, and restore her
15 And [the] root which it planted right [hand] your and on [the] son [whom] you made strong for yourself.
the vine which your right hand has planted.
16 [it is] burned With fire [it is] cut down from [the] rebuke of face your they will perish.
She is burned with fire and cut down before your stern face they are perishing.
17 May it be hand your on [the] man of right [hand] your on [the] son of humankind [whom] you have made strong for yourself.
Support the one you have chosen, the one you have raised for yourself;
18 And not we will turn back from you you will give life us and on name your we will call.
then from you we will never draw back. Preserve us, and we will call on your name.
19 O Yahweh God of hosts restore us make shine face your so let us be delivered.
Lord, God of hosts, restore us: Show us the light of your face, so we may be saved.
